What if your business could have the intelligence and agility of an octopus?In AI and the Octopus Organization: Building the Superintelligent Firm, leading futurist Jonathan Brill and innovation expert Stephen Wunker unveil a groundbreaking vision for how organizations must evolve to survive and thrive in the age of artificial intelligence. Drawing inspiration from the octopus, an ancient creature noted for both rapid adaptation and distributed intelligence, the authors show that only businesses that rewire their structure, leadership, and decision-making can unlock AI's full potential.This is not another book about chatbots or automation. It’s a deeply researched, vividly told blueprint for transforming businesses so that they can make the most of AI. The secrets explored include what skills to cultivate, how to excel with human + AI combinations, how to organize teams for maximum impact, and how to deal with the emotional side of AI-driven change. This book is a practical guide to shaping an AI business strategy for executives who need to lead at scale without losing agility. The book describes how AI is already reshaping growth, coordination, and culture, providing an actionable roadmap to what the authors call the Octopus Organization™, one that can navigate the change ahead.Backed by over two million data points from workforce surveys, insights from 50+ global leaders, and real-world case studies from companies like Procter & Gamble, Siemens, and Stripe, AI and the Octopus Organization reveals how your company can:Empower the frontline with AI-enhanced autonomyCreate networks for decision-making across silosRapidly adapt to disruptions without losing controlBuild a culture that embraces experimentationReplace old approaches with superintelligent coordinationIf you found the breakthrough thinking of The Innovator’s Dilemma or Team of Teams transformative, AI and the Octopus Organization belongs on your shelf. The book contains:Introduction Why Transform?Chapter 1 Reimagining Growth: The key macro issues that make AI-enabled organizational change necessaryChapter 2 Eight Arms: How to delegate decision-making with AI while maintaining alignment and consistencyChapter 3 Neural Necklace: How to work with AI to make context-rich information discoverable in real timeChapter 4 Three Hearts: Modes of leadership that avoid both command-and-control relapse and free-for-all anarchyChapter 5 RNA-Powered Resilience: How to turn resilience into a standing capability rather than a post-crisis recoveryChapter 6 An Emotional Being: How to overcome the trust issues that silently kill AI transformationsChapter 7 Strategic Serendipity: Ways to convert uncertainty from threat to managed assetChapter 8 Your Transformation Plan: The step-by-step approach to managing AI transformationAppendix Scaling Enterprise AI Read more
